According to an RJC auditor, providers only require to pledge that they conduct solid human legal rights due persistance, however do not give any type of proof for this. Neither does the Code of Practices require jewelersor various other downstream companiesto have traceability or chain of custody of their gold or diamonds. The Code of Practices is additionally weak in other substantive areas, for instance, on aboriginal individuals' legal rights and on resettlement.In March 2017, the RJC had 342 members that had not (yet) finished the audit process that accredits compliance with the Code of Practices. On top of that, business can join at any degree of their procedures. For instance, a tiny subsidiary workplace of a big precious jewelry company could request RJC membership, without consisting of the remainder of the firm's entities.
The Code of Practices does not call for firms to publicly report on the concrete actions they have taken to carry out due diligencea core need of the OECD Advice (Citizen Watches). Its coverage obligations are vague and do not mention due persistance or the demand for firms to report on the steps they have required to determine, analyze, and minimize risks in their supply chains

A second RJC requirement, the Chain-of-Custody Requirement, advertises traceability and is much more strenuous, but adherence to it is optional for RJC members. By early 2018, just 48 of over 1,000 participant companies had actually certified entities under the standard, consisting of 13 jewelers. The Chain-of-Custody Requirement needs companies to establish documentary proof of business purchases along the supply chain and to confirm they are not triggering damaging effects in conflict-affected and risky areas.
Rather, companies are permitted to select some "entities" under their control for qualification, leaving various other entities of a company uncertified. While this may allow for companies to gradually change over to even more liable sourcing practices, the existing technique also brings the danger that a whole business enjoys the reputational advantage when the bulk of procedures is not in compliance with the standard.
All RJC member firms need to undergo an audit to show that they are compliant with the Code of Practices, and to receive qualification. Those firms that pick to obtain accreditation for the Chain-of-Custody Requirement have to undertake a different audit. Audits are based mostly on a testimonial of the business's composed policies and paperwork, and sees to a "depictive set" of facilities.

Although audits are supposed to consist of inquiries on a broad series of human legal rights, auditors are not always certified civils rights professionals. Once the auditors finish their report, they only send a summary record of the audit to the RJC, not the complete audit record, which is shared just with the firm
While labor misuses are extensive in the sector, artisanal mines offer revenue for numerous workers and countless mining communities. Civil rights Watch believes that the fashion jewelry sector should strive to guarantee that their efforts to minimize supply chain human legal rights dangers do not lead them to just exclude all artisanal providers from their supply chains as the "course of least resistance." Rather, they ought to sustain initiatives to formalize and professionalize artisanal mines and boost working conditions.
The OECD Fee Diligence Guidance acknowledges this and is advertising cost-sharing within the market. In this way, all business along the supply chain share the financial problem. A variety of efforts have arised that can aid jewelry experts trace their gold and rubies to mines of origin, and extra responsibly source from visit this web-site the artisanal industry.

2 standardscertify artisanal and small gold mines that adapt to human legal rights, labor civil liberties, and ecological standardsthe Fairmined Criterion and the Fairtrade Gold Standard (moissanite rings). Depending on the consumer's permit with Fairmined, the gold may be completely traceable to the mine of origin, or might be blended with various other gold.
This quantity is simply a small fraction of the gold used yearly by several of the companies examined in this report. Since early 2018, eight mines in four countries (Bolivia, Colombia, Mongolia, and Peru) were licensed, with an extra 20 mining companies working in the direction of qualification. The Fairmined Gold Standard is presently establishing a new "market access" requirement that seeks to help artisanal gold mines while doing so towards full certification.
